About the Role
An exciting opportunity has arisen for a talented Maths Teacher to join an Ofsted Outstanding mixed non-faith secondary school in Leeds. The successful candidate will teach Mathematics across KS3 KS4 and KS5 delivering an engaging and challenging curriculum that develops students problem-solving abilities logical reasoning and confidence in numeracy. This is an excellent chance to join a high-achieving department that consistently delivers exceptional results and fosters a genuine love of learning.

About the School
This Ofsted Outstanding mixed non-faith academy has approximately 1350 students on roll including a vibrant sixth form of around 300 students. The school has an exceptional academic record with 74% of students achieving grades 94 in English and Maths at GCSE and a Progress 8 score well above the national average. At A-Level over 60% of students achieve AB grades* with Mathematics being one of the most popular and successful subjects regularly sending students on to Russell Group universities.

The school is known for excellent behaviour a supportive ethos and high levels of student engagement in enrichment and extracurricular opportunities. With modern facilities specialist classrooms and dedicated sixth form study areas both staff and students thrive in an environment that promotes ambition collaboration and academic excellence.
